The California Immigrant Youth Justice Alliance (CIYJA) put together a resource guide for undocumented immigrants living in California. It features information about workers’ rights, access to free food, financial assistance, and more. The guide is available in both Spanish and English. Because health care is local, we have Community Resource Centers across Los Angeles County to improve the quality of life of everyone in the community. Each center serves as a one-stop community destination, providing free fitness, health and wellness classes and services to help center visitors stay active, healthy and informed.

They could be businesses, organizations, public service institutions or individuals in the … galeforce fire emblem A community asset (or community resource, a very similar term) is anything that can be used to improve the quality of community life. And this means: It can be a person -- Residents can be empowered to realize and use their abilities to build and transform the community. The stay-at-home mom or dad who organizes a playgroup.
